This apartment in the Testaccio neighbourhood of Rome is a shining example of a somewhere we'd be more than happy to stay in the Italian capital. Quite literally in the case of the gleaming chequerboard tiling, parquet-style flooring and black marble in the master bathroom, which reflect the light beautifully and make this home feel gloriously light. The open-concept kitchen-dining area feels geared towards shared mealtimes, which is only appropriate given the locale's reputation as a gastronomic hotspot. Stroll over to Testaccio's glass-roofed market in under ten minutes and pick up some fresh ingredients for a home-prepared feast. Alternatively, if you're feeling lazy — or intrepid, however you want to frame it — there are a wide choice of restaurants nearby from which to take your pick.

Staying in Aventino

As one of the city's legendary seven hills, the Aventine plays a central role in the founding mythology of Rome. In ancient times it was a hive of activity – the home of foreign religious cults and dens of iniquity that caused consternation among the powers that be.
